NameStatusPopulation
Census
2011-03-01
GanderbalDistrict297,446
GanderbalTehsil85,818
KanganTehsil120,934
LarTehsil90,694
Jammu & KashmirUnion Territory12,267,013

Source: Office of the Registrar General and Census Commissioner.

Explanation: States and districts in the boundaries of 2023; subdistricts in the boundaries of 2011. Population figures of new delimitated districts and split subdistricts are mostly computed by using subdistricts or villages in the boundaries of 2011. Thus, slight deviatiations from the actual population are possible in some cases. Area figures are mostly derived from geospatial data.
